Key Features to Look For

Selecting the right sewing awl kit for stitching leather means paying attention to specific features. A crucial factor is the presence of multiple needles, each with a different curvature or angle for handling diverse stitching tasks. Look for a kit that includes a comfortable handle, providing a secure grip and reducing hand fatigue during extended use. The ability to adjust the needle angle is a significant advantage, allowing you to customize your stitching based on the leather thickness and project complexity.
* Needle variety (straight, curved, angled)
* Ergonomic handle for comfort
* Adjustable needle angle

Important Materials

The materials used in your sewing awl kit for stitching leather will directly impact its longevity. Seek out awl bodies and needles crafted from hardened steel, known for its ability to resist bending and breaking during use. The handle should be made from durable materials like wood or sturdy plastics, ensuring it can withstand repeated use. Avoid kits that feature low-quality materials that may rust quickly or become brittle.
* Hardened steel needles
* Durable handle material
* Avoid cheap, easily breakable materials

Essential Factors We Consider

While awls are simple tools, key characteristics determine their ease of use and the quality of stitches. Consider the awl’s overall weight and balance, as this will impact control. The thread size compatibility is vital; choose a kit that accommodates the thread weight you plan to use. Carefully observe the awl’s sharpness; a well-sharpened awl creates clean, easy-to-use holes, making stitching easier.
* Weight and balance for control
* Thread size compatibility
* Sharpness of the awl
